




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
单片机级的内部通讯协议5篇篇1一、引言单片机级的内部通讯协议是连接单片机内部各个模块的重要桥梁,对于单片机的整体性能和稳定性起着至关重要的作用。为了规范单片机的内部通讯,提高单片机的开发效率和可靠性,本文档旨在定义一套清晰、严谨的单片机级内部通讯协议。二、术语与定义1.单片机:指内含中央处理器(CPU)、内存(RAM/ROM)、输入输出(I/O)接口等电路和功能的微型计算机。2.内部通讯协议:指单片机内部各个模块之间为了传输信息而遵循的规则和约定。3.模块:指单片机内部具有特定功能的电路或软件单元。4.信号:指用于传输信息的物理量,如电压、电流等。三、通讯协议规范1.通讯介质:单片机的内部通讯通常使用电气连接(如总线、引脚等)作为通讯介质。2.通讯方式:单片机的内部通讯可以采用轮询、中断、DMA(直接内存访问)等方式。具体采用哪种方式,应根据实际应用需求和数据传输特点来决定。3.通讯速率:单片机的内部通讯速率应满足实际应用需求,同时考虑单片机的硬件资源和功耗等因素。4.通讯协议栈:单片机的内部通讯协议栈应简洁、高效,尽量减少通讯层级和复杂度,以提高通讯速度和可靠性。四、模块接口规范1.模块接口:每个模块应有明确的输入输出接口,接口应包括信号类型、信号数量、信号顺序等关键信息。2.接口连接:模块之间的接口连接应规范、可靠,确保信号传输的稳定性和准确性。3.信号命名:信号的命名应清晰、简洁,反映信号的实际含义和作用。4.信号时序:信号的时序关系应明确,包括信号的上升沿、下降沿、保持时间等关键参数。五、数据格式与编码1.数据格式:单片机内部传输的数据格式应符合实际应用需求,如采用ASCII码、十六进制数等。2.编码方式:为了提高数据传送的可靠性和稳定性,可以采用校验码、循环冗余校验(CRC)等编码方式。3.数据长度:数据的长度应满足实际应用需求,同时考虑单片机的硬件资源和功耗等因素。六、错误处理与异常处理1.错误检测:应能检测通讯过程中的错误,如数据丢失、数据错误等。2.错误处理:当检测到错误时,应能采取相应的错误处理措施,如重发数据、丢弃数据等。3.异常处理:当模块出现异常情况时,应能采取相应的异常处理措施,如模块复位、系统重启等。七、测试与验证1.测试方法:应制定详细的测试方法,包括单元测试、集成测试等,以确保单片机的内部通讯协议的正确性和稳定性。2.测试环境:测试环境应模拟单片机的实际运行环境,包括硬件环境、软件环境等。3.验证手段:通过测试验证单片机的内部通讯协议是否符合规范,是否存在潜在问题。同时,可通过日志记录、调试信息等方式辅助验证。八、总结与展望本文档详细定义了单片机级的内部通讯协议规范,包括通讯介质、通讯方式、通讯速率、通讯协议栈等方面。同时,也规范了模块接口、数据格式与编码、错误处理与异常处理等关键内容。这些规范有助于提高单片机的开发效率和可靠性,为单片机的广泛应用和推广提供了有力的支持。未来,随着技术的不断进步和发展,单片机级的内部通讯协议将会更加完善和优化,以满足更多复杂和多样化的应用场景需求。篇2本合同由以下双方于XXXX年XX月XX日签订:甲方:XXX公司地址:XXXXXX法定代表人:XXXXXX乙方:XXX公司地址:XXXXXX法定代表人:XXXXXX鉴于甲方需要与乙方进行单片机级的内部通讯,双方本着互利共赢、共同发展的原则,经友好协商,达成如下协议:一、合作内容1.甲方与乙方共同开发和维护单片机级的内部通讯协议,确保双方能够高效、安全地进行信息传输。2.具体合作内容包括但不限于:-通讯协议的技术标准、格式和版本管理;-通讯协议的测试、验证和优化;-通讯协议的相关文档编写和更新;-通讯协议的培训和技术支持。二、双方权利与义务1.甲方权利与义务:-提供单片机相关的技术资料和开发环境;-参与通讯协议的技术标准和格式制定;-负责协议测试、验证和优化的相关工作;-及时支付合同约定的费用。2.乙方权利与义务:-提供单片机级的内部通讯协议详细设计和实现方案;-负责通讯协议的测试、验证和优化工作;-编写和维护通讯协议的相关文档;-提供必要的培训和技术支持。三、合作期限本合同自签订之日起生效,有效期为XX年。期满后,双方可协商续签。四、费用与支付方式1.甲方需支付乙方以下费用:-通讯协议维护和更新的费用;-相关文档编写和更新的费用;-培训和技术支持的费用。2.支付方式:-甲方需在合同签订后支付乙方XX%的预付款;-在通讯协议开发完成并经双方验收合格后,支付剩余的XX%;-对于后续的维护、更新、文档编写和支持工作,甲方需在服务完成后及时支付相应费用。五、保密条款1.双方应对合作过程中涉及的技术资料、开发环境、测试数据等敏感信息严格保密,不得泄露给任何第三方。2.未经对方书面同意,任何一方不得将本合同项下的权利和义务转让给第三方。3.本保密条款自合同签订之日起生效,有效期与合同有效期相同。六、违约责任1.若甲方未按照合同约定支付费用,乙方有权暂停相关服务和支持,直至甲方支付全部应付款项。2.若乙方未按照合同约定提供服务和支持,甲方有权要求乙方进行整改,并赔偿因此造成的损失。3.双方应本着友好协商的原则解决合同履行过程中的争议,若协商无果,可通过仲裁或诉讼方式解决。七、其他条款1.本合同未尽事宜,可由双方另行协商并签订补充协议。补充协议与本合同具有同等法律效力。2.本合同的修改和补充,应遵循双方平等自愿、协商一致的原则。任何单方擅自修改或终止合同的行为将视为违约。3.本合同一式两份,甲乙双方各执一份。合同文本具有同等法律效力。篇3一、引言本合同协议旨在规范单片机级的内部通讯,确保各单片机单元之间能够高效、准确地传递信息。通过明确通讯协议,可提高系统的稳定性和可靠性,促进各单元之间的协同工作。二、定义与术语1.单片机:指具有特定功能的微型计算机,可在嵌入式系统中发挥核心作用。2.内部通讯:指单片机内部各单元、模块之间的信息传输与交互。3.协议:指规定通讯双方如何进行沟通的规范,包括通讯方式、格式、内容等。三、通讯协议1.通讯方式:本合同协议采用硬件和软件相结合的方式实现内部通讯。硬件方面,利用单片机的引脚、总线等物理连接实现电气连接;软件方面,通过编写程序、调用函数等方式实现逻辑连接。2.通讯格式:所有通讯数据必须遵循统一的格式,包括数据长度、数据类型、字段顺序等。具体格式如下:-起始位:用于标识数据包的开始,采用固定值表示。-目标地址:表示接收数据的单元或模块地址。-数据长度:表示后续数据的长度。-数据类型:表示后续数据的类型,如整数、浮点数等。-字段顺序:表示数据的字段顺序,需遵循一定的规则。-校验位:用于校验数据的完整性,采用固定值表示。-停止位:用于标识数据包的结束,采用固定值表示。3.通讯内容:所有通讯数据必须包含有意义的内容,包括控制指令、状态信息、数据信息等。具体内容包括:-控制指令:用于指示接收数据的单元或模块执行特定的操作,如读取数据、写入数据等。-状态信息:表示接收数据的单元或模块的状态,如工作状态、错误状态等。-数据信息:表示接收数据的单元或模块需要处理的数据,如数值、字符串等。四、发送与接收1.发送方:负责将数据按照规定的格式发送出去,确保数据能够准确到达接收方。2.接收方:负责接收数据,并按照规定的格式解析数据,确保能够正确理解数据内容。五、错误处理1.发送方在发送数据时,应确保数据的完整性和准确性。如果数据在发送过程中发生错误,发送方应重新发送正确数据。2.接收方在接收数据时,应校验数据的完整性和准确性。如果发现数据错误或丢失,接收方应请求发送方重新发送数据。六、总结本合同协议明确了单片机级的内部通讯规范,包括通讯方式、格式和内容等。通过遵循该协议,可确保各单片机单元之间能够高效、准确地传递信息,提高系统的稳定性和可靠性。同时,该协议也为开发者提供了统一的接口和规范的参考,便于进行模块化的设计和开发。篇4#一、引言本合同协议旨在规范单片机级内部通讯的各个方面,确保不同单片机系统之间的顺畅、准确、安全通信。通过明确双方的权利和义务,规范通信流程,以及设定相应的法律后果,来保障单片机系统的稳定运行和高效协作。#二、定义与术语1.单片机:指嵌入式系统中的微控制器,负责控制和管理系统的各项功能。2.内部通讯协议:指单片机之间为了传递信息而遵循的约定和规范。3.系统管理员:负责管理和维护单片机系统的专业人员。4.通信接口:指单片机之间用于数据传输和控制的物理或逻辑接口。#三、系统要求1.兼容性:所有单片机应支持本合同协议,确保系统之间的无缝连接和高效协作。2.安全性:系统应提供必要的安全措施,如数据加密、身份验证等,确保信息的安全传输和存储。3.稳定性:系统应设计合理的容错机制,确保在遇到故障或错误时能够保持稳定运行。#四、通信流程1.建立连接:首先,两个单片机需要通过协商确定通信接口和参数,建立连接。2.发送请求:一方单片机可以向另一方发送请求,如读取数据、控制设备等。3.接收响应:接收方单片机在收到请求后,应尽快给出响应,包括确认、拒绝或提供所需数据。4.关闭连接:当一方不再需要通信时,应通知另一方关闭连接。#五、权利义务1.权利:-单片机有权选择是否参与本系统,并在遵守规定的前提下自由地进行通信。-系统管理员有权对系统进行监控和管理,确保系统的稳定运行。2.义务:-单片机应严格遵守系统的各项规定,确保信息的准确传输和系统的稳定运行。-系统管理员应及时响应并解决系统中的问题,确保系统的高效协作和顺畅运行。#六、法律后果1.违约责任:如果一方违反了本合同的任何条款,应承担相应的法律责任。具体责任形式包括但不限于赔偿损失、支付违约金等。2.侵权责:如果一方侵犯了另一方的合法权益,如窃取数据、破坏系统等,应依法承担相应的法律责任。3.其他法律后果:其他违反本合同协议的行为,将依据相关法律法规进行处理。#七、争议解决1.协商和解:首先,双方应尝试通过友好协商的方式解决争议。2.仲裁解决:如果协商无果,双方可以向相关仲裁机构申请仲裁。仲裁裁决具有法律效力,双方应履行裁决结果。3.诉讼解决:如果仲裁结果仍无法让双方满意,双方可以向人民法院提起诉讼。诉讼结果将依据相关法律法规进行判决。#八、合同生效与终止1.合同生效:本合同自双方签字或盖章之日起生效。2.合同终止:有下列情形之一的,合同可以终止:-双方协商同意终止合同;-一方严重违反合同约定,导致合同无法继续履行;-其他符合法律法规规定的情形。#九、其他未尽事宜1.补充条款:本合同未尽事宜,双方可以协商补充条款,作为本合同的组成部分。2.解释权:本合同的解释权归双方所有。如有任何疑问或争议,双方应共同协商解决。篇5#甲方(设备方):1.公司名称:XXX科技有限公司2.地址:XX省XX市XX区XX路XX号3.联系人:XXX4.联系电话:+86-123-4567-89015.传真:+86-123-4567-89026.邮箱:info@#乙方(服务方):1.公司名称:YYY信息技术有限公司2.地址:XX省XX市XX区XX路XX号3.联系人:YYY4.联系电话:+86-654-3210-98765.传真:+86-654-3210-98776.邮箱:info@#协议内容:一、引言本协议旨在明确甲方(设备方)与乙方(服务方)在单片机级内部通讯协议开发过程中的权利与义务。双方经过友好协商,达成以下协议条款。二、项目概述1.项目名称:单片机级内部通讯协议开发2.项目目标:开发一套高效、稳定的单片机级内部通讯协议,确保数据传输的准确性和实时性。3.项目范围:包括但不限于协议栈的设计、编码、测试、优化以及文档编写等工作。三、双方职责与义务1.甲方职责:-提供项目的整体框架和具体要求;-协调乙方与项目其他相关方的沟通;-按照协议支付乙方相应的开发费用。2.乙方职责:-按照甲方要求,确保开发进度和质量;-提供必要的文档和注释,方便甲方和其他开发者使用和维护协议。四、开发进度与质量控制1.开发进度:乙方应制定详细的项目计划,并按照计划推进开发工作。甲方有权对开发进度进行监督,并提出合理的调整建议。2.质量控制:乙方应确保开发过程中的工作质量,包括代码编写、测试等关键环节。甲方有权对开发成果进行验收,并提出改进意见。五、保密条款1.双方应对项目相关的技术资料、商业机密等信息进行保密,不得擅自泄露给第三方。2.保密期限为项目结束后一年内,双方应继续对保密信息保密。六、费用与支付条款1.开发费用:甲方应支付乙方相应的开发费用,具体金额和支付方式双方应另行协商确定。2.支付方式:甲方应按照项目进展情况分阶段支付开发费用,确保乙方能够及时收到款项。乙方应提供
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 变电站道路施工方案
- Unit 7 Happy Birthday Section A 2a 教学设计2024-2025学年人教版英语七年级上册
- 厨师务工合同范本
- 叫停温泉开采合同范例
- 提升个人财务素养的方法与途径计划
- 创设多样学习场景提升幼儿园小班的学习兴趣计划
- 人体器官捐献知识普及方案计划
- 创意手工活动的实施方案计划
- 课程实施细则计划
- 提升工作效率的年度措施计划
- 人教版(2025新版)七年级下册数学第七章 相交线与平行线 单元测试卷(含答案)
- 汽轮机辅机培训
- 国之重器:如何突破关键技术-笔记
- 早产儿和低出生体重儿袋鼠式护理临床实践指南(2024)解读1
- 三废环保管理培训
- 《中外历史纲要上》第4课 西汉与东汉-统一多民族封建国家的巩固(课件)(共23张PPT)
- 模具首试前检验标准
- 格宾网施工规程水利
- [转载]郑桂华《安塞腰鼓》教学实录
- 药品销售管理制度试卷
- 大庆油田有限责任公司闲置、报废资产处置管理办
评论
0/150
提交评论